  • Abstract
    Parameters for the 3W1 source at BSRF were determined in both the dedicated and parasitic mode and their suitability for protein crystallography beamline at BSRF were realized. It is discussed that the physics motivation and the design of the 3W1 is compared with similar experimental stations at the Brazilian Light Source (1.37 Gev) and Max-II in Sweden (1.5 GeV). The photon flux from the 3W1 source is about 2×1011 photon/s mA in the wavelength range of 2.0–0.9 Å in parasitic mode and 50–80 times higher in the dedicated mode. Both the dedicated and parasitic modes are suitable for macromolecular structure experiments.
